Dirkson "Dirk" D'Agostino is a male Capitol Motors Verve XT who competed in the Piston Cup Racing Series for over ten years. However, once Piston Cup teams realize that next-generation racers are more capable than traditional stock racers, Trunk Fresh fires Dirkson and replaces him with a next generation racer named Steve LaPage. He is painted light green and black, with the Trunk Fresh logo painted on his hood. He has the number 34 painted in light green on his doors and roof, and light green rims.
History
Cars
In Cars, Dirkson is one of the thirty-six Piston Cup racers that compete in the Dinoco 400 at the Motor Speedway of the South. When Chick Hicks creates a large wreck in hopes of distancing himself from Lightning McQueen, Dirkson is involved in the crash, and receives some light damage. However, he is able to continue racing after a pit stop.
Cars 3
In Cars 3, Dirkson competes in the 2016 Piston Cup season, against the likes of Lightning McQueen, Jackson Storm, and many others.[1] Storm's successful debut influences other Piston Cup teams to consider hiring next-generation racers instead of their old ones. After finishing in eighth place at Copper Canyon Speedway, he becomes one of many traditional racers who are fired and replaced by more powerful cars.
Appearances
Profiles and statistics
Cars
- Bios
- "Dirkson "Dirk" D'Agostino discovered his natural racing talent while working in the graphics department for a small racing outfit. Running errands between buildings he dodged all kinds of obstacles at insane speeds. One day Dirkson caught the eye of the race shop's owner, who fired the young upstart for what he considered reckless driving in the workplace, and rehired him as one of his pro racers, for what he considered a natural talent on the race track."[2]
